Zetwerk Eyes ₹500 Cr Pre-IPO Round at $3 Billion Valuation Amid Strong Investor Interest

Zetwerk is preparing to raise approximately ₹500 crore in a pre-IPO funding round, targeting a valuation of nearly $3 billion, as the company gears up for its public market debut. The development highlights growing investor confidence in India’s B2B manufacturing and supply chain ecosystem.

Strong Investor Appetite Ahead of IPO

According to industry sources, Zetwerk has already attracted significant interest from both domestic and global investors, including private equity firms and institutional backers. The pre-IPO round is expected to help the company strengthen its balance sheet and accelerate growth before filing its IPO papers.

The funding comes at a time when late-stage capital deployment remains cautious, but companies with strong fundamentals and profitability visibility—like Zetwerk—continue to draw attention.

Growth Driven by Manufacturing and Global Expansion

Founded in 2018, Zetwerk operates as a managed marketplace for contract manufacturing, connecting businesses with a network of suppliers across industries such as:

  • Aerospace
  • Renewables
  • Consumer electronics
  • Industrial machinery

The company has steadily expanded its global footprint, particularly in the US, Europe, and Southeast Asia, positioning itself as a key player in the global supply chain diversification trend.

Financial Performance and Business Momentum

Zetwerk has demonstrated consistent revenue growth, supported by increasing demand for outsourced manufacturing and supply chain solutions. Its asset-light model and technology-driven operations have enabled it to scale efficiently while maintaining operational control.

The company has also been focusing on improving margins and operational efficiencies, a critical factor for investors evaluating pre-IPO opportunities in the current market environment.

IPO Plans and Market Timing

The planned pre-IPO round is widely seen as a strategic step toward a public listing, which could take place within the next 12–18 months, depending on market conditions.

With India’s IPO market gradually stabilizing, companies like Zetwerk are aiming to capitalize on renewed investor interest in high-growth, tech-enabled businesses.
